L’Orestea nel nuovo millennio: il re-enactment di Milo Rau

Massimo Fusillo    Università degli Studi dell’Aquila, Italia    

VIEW PDF DOWNLOAD PDF

abstract

This paper deals first with 20th century prominent performances and rewritings of Aeschylus’ Oresteia, focusing especially on their clear political potential: it analyses then Milo Rau’s poetics, which brilliantly combines empathy and estrangement; and finally offers a close reading of Rau’s Orestes in Mosul, which highlights the contamination between myth and reality, video and acting, classical text and political re-enactment.
